PMPI (4-Maleimidophenyl isocyanate)

Thermo Scientific Pierce PMPI is a maleimide-and-isocyanate crosslinker for attaching compounds to sulfhydryl groups (cysteines) after conjugating the linker to hydroxyl groups on a molecule by urethane (carbamate) bonds.


  • Reactive groups: maleimide and isocyanate
  • Reactive towards: sulfhydryl and hydroxyl groups
  • Short (8.7A), sulfhydryl-to-hydroxyl crosslinker with an aromatic spacer arm (noncleavable)
  • Maleimide group reacts with sulfhydryl groups to form stable thioether linkages
  • Isocyanate reacts with non-aqueous hydroxyl groups to form carbamate linkage
  • Excellent tool for conjugating hydroxyl-containing compounds such as steroids and vitamins
  • Targets and reaction solutions must not contain primary amines
